Repair And Maintenance Expenses



Many novice home purchasers take too lightly the value of budgeting for repair and maintenance expenses, which can promptly build up after moving in. It's not simply the acquisition rate that matters; there are recurring costs you need to take right into account. Residences require normal maintenance, from grass treatment to plumbing fixings. You might encounter unanticipated issues like a leaking roofing system or faulty devices, which can hit your budget hard. Experts suggest setting aside 1% to 3% of your home's value every year for upkeep. This way, you're prepared for both regular and shock expenses. OC Home Buyers. Don't allow these prices capture you unsuspecting-- variable them into your budget to ensure a smoother change right into homeownership.


Skipping the Home Loan Pre-Approval Process



Often, first-time home customers ignore the value of getting pre-approved for a home loan before starting their home search. This step isn't just a procedure; it's necessary for specifying your budget plan and improving your search. Without pre-approval, you take the chance of falling for a home you can't pay for, throwing away time and energy.


Pre-approval offers you a clear concept of just how much you can obtain, making you an extra appealing purchaser. Sellers often choose offers from pre-approved buyers due to the fact that it reveals you're severe and monetarily all set.


Additionally, skipping this step can bring about delays later on. When you discover a home you love, you'll intend to act promptly, and having your financial resources figured out beforehand can make all the distinction. Do not underestimate the power of pre-approval; it establishes a strong foundation for your home-buying trip.

What Are Closing Prices, and How Much Should I Expect to Pay?



Closing expenses are fees due at the home acquisition's end, including funding source, assessment, and title insurance policy. You should expect to pay regarding 2% to 5% of the home's rate in closing costs.
